What it does

BloombergGPT is a large language model developed by Bloomberg and trained on a massive corpus of financial text - Bloomberg's proprietary news archive, filings, financial reports, and other financial domain content - alongside general text data. At 50 billion parameters, it was purpose-built to outperform general LLMs on financial NLP tasks: sentiment analysis of earnings call transcripts, named entity recognition of financial instruments and companies, financial question answering, and headline classification. Bloomberg uses BloombergGPT internally to power AI features within the Bloomberg Terminal and financial data products. It is not a general-purpose commercial LLM available for external deployment but represents the direction of domain-specific financial AI that Bloomberg is building into its products.

Watch-outs

  • Not publicly available as a standalone model: BloombergGPT is Bloomberg's proprietary internal model — it is not available through an API or model marketplace for external use. Financial organizations wanting domain-trained LLMs must use other providers or fine-tune general models.
  • Benefits flow through Bloomberg products only: BloombergGPT's capabilities are accessible only through Bloomberg Terminal features — organizations without Bloomberg subscriptions cannot access the model's financial NLP capabilities.
  • Financial NLP is one use case among many: BloombergGPT excels at financial text analysis tasks but is not designed for the broad reasoning, code generation, or general task completion that general-purpose LLMs like Claude or GPT-4 handle — it is a specialist, not a generalist.

Pricing

BloombergGPT is not commercially available as a standalone model. Access is embedded within {{bloomberg-terminal}} subscriptions (approximately $24,000/user/year). No separate pricing.
